In this review the Duco clear cast acrylic sheets are evaluated for DIYers and light commercial use who need a glass-like panel that is lighter and stronger than glass. The bottom line: these 24 in x 24 in, 1/4 in thick panels deliver excellent optical clarity and UV resistance, making them a strong choice for protective screens, display covers, and window replacements where weight and shatter resistance matter most. The review finds the sheets easy to work with but notes the factory cut tolerance and occasional edge chipping reported by some users.
Key Features
- Made in the USA: The sheets are manufactured domestically, which provides consistent material quality and optical clarity.
- Optical clarity: These 1/4 in panels offer glass-like transparency that is well suited for displays, signs, and window replacements.
- Durable and lightweight: At roughly half the weight of glass and up to 10 times the impact strength, the panels are easy to handle and more shatter-resistant.
- Protected for transit: Each 24 in x 24 in sheet arrives with a removable protective film to minimize scratching during shipping and handling.
- Easy to machine: The acrylic cuts, drills, and routes cleanly with common tools such as table saws, routers, CNC machines, or lasers for precise DIY projects.
- UV resistant: Built-in UV resistance helps preserve clarity and limits yellowing for long-term applications.
Who It's For
The panels are ideal for homeowners replacing interior window panes, crafters making signs or display cases, and small shops needing lightweight protective barriers or table protectors. The combination of optical clarity and impact resistance suits applications where visibility and safety matter.
Those who require perfectly precise dimensions to the thousandth of an inch or who need thicker structural glazing should look elsewhere; the sheets come with a stated 1/8 in cut tolerance and some customers have noted occasional edge chipping during cutting or trimming.

Specifications
| Material | Clear cast acrylic |
| Thickness | 1/4 in (approx 6 mm) |
| Dimensions | 24 in x 24 in per sheet |
| Pack quantity | 2 sheets |
| Origin | Made in the USA |
| Surface protection | Removable protective film |
| Cut tolerance | Approximately 1/8 in |

Frequently Asked Questions
Are these sheets safe to use as a glass replacement?
Yes, they offer glass-like clarity and are significantly more impact resistant, but double-check the 1/8 in cut tolerance for precise fit jobs.
Can these acrylic panels be cut or drilled at home?
Yes, they cut and drill cleanly with a table saw, router, or drill, but use appropriate blades and feed rates to avoid edge chipping.
Do the sheets come protected?
Each sheet is wrapped in a removable protective film to prevent scratches during transit and handling.
